Christmas magic can thaw the coldest of hearts…

Sylvie Magnusson is going to be lonely this Christmas. Instead of jetting off for her
sunshine honeymoon, she’s freezing at home in Cheshire. Guess that’s what happens when your fiancé dumps you a week before your wedding…

Sylvie’s best friend, Nari, plans a trip to see the Northern Lights and get Sylvie’s mojo back. But as their Lapland getaway approaches, Sylvie realises that Frozen Falls is the hometown of Stellan Virtanen, her dreamy Finnish ex-boyfriend, the one that got away. Even though he actually ran away, and Sylvie never understood why…

Luckily, when they meet, Stellan’s still gorgeous – and her heart is warmed when he shows her the romantic delights of Lapland (as well as some seriously adorable Husky puppies). But when she returns to England can she really leave Stellan behind? Or will she find that her heart belongs in the frozen North?

It's beginning to feel a bit like Christmas or at least Winter, and having read Christmas at Frozen Falls, I just want to pack my bags and spend Christmas this year in Lapland. 

Ok in reality its a tiny bit too cold for my liking, so I'll probably spend it in a much warmer destination - but wow who wouldn't want to go husky sledding,  take a sleigh ride with real reindeer and generally spend a few days at the place that we all know the real Santa lives! 

This really is a bit of Christmas magic, seeing how Sylvie and Nari take a last min trip to Lapland, and go to the resort where  Sylvie's ex-boyfriend Stellan is from and might be there.   In fact we get to meet not only Stellan but also reindeer herder Niilo, who believes Nari may be his soulmate. 

Frozen Falls is such a gorgeous location for book,  I really felt I was there alongside Sylvie and Nari, its utterly stunning, and if it can't ignite some Christmas feeling in you then nothing will. 

I loved seeing how both ladies interacted with their potential romances, and as well as being on holiday together they spend quite a bit of time apart. 

It is clear that Finnish Lapland has been well researched with mentions of Finnish customs, and odd phrases in Finnish put in too for flavour.  I loved learning about the sauna customs, and also the mentions that Finn men are slightly quieter, less demonstrative than the male species of other Scandinavian countries. 

Oh and the huskies, just how adorable are they.  Please can I have a husky puppy for Christmas, I really want to give one a big cuddle, and if i had a team of them, I'd be able to rather unique transport!!  They really are great and Sylvie spends quite a bit of time with the dogs in this, as she is even more enchanted than I am with them. 

Christmas at Frozen Falls is a wonderful start to my Christmas reading this year,  its full of festive feeling, fabulous characters,  friends, family,  snow and all sorts of traditional Lappish food and customs.  I just loved every second of this book.  

This may only be Kiley Dunbar's second book, but I can already tell these are the start of a long writing career (I hope), as I am loving her writing,. I can't wait to see what is next.
